🎓 What is a Research Fellow?
A Research Fellow is a specialized academic position focused on conducting high-level research within universities or research institutions. The term Research Fellow refers to a researcher who is typically supported by external grants or fellowships to pursue independent or team-based projects. This role emerged in the early 20th century in institutions like Oxford and Cambridge, evolving globally to support postdoctoral scholars advancing knowledge in their fields.
In higher education, the Research Fellow meaning centers on innovation and discovery, distinguishing it from teaching-heavy roles. Research Fellows often bridge the gap between graduate studies and permanent faculty positions, contributing publications, presentations, and policy impacts. Required Qualifications and Skills for Research Fellows
To secure Research Fellow jobs in Honduras or elsewhere, candidates need strong academic credentials. Required academic qualifications usually include a Doctor of Philosophy (PhD) or equivalent doctoral degree in a relevant field such as environmental science, public health, or social sciences—areas prominent in Honduran research.
- Research focus or expertise needed: Specialized knowledge in niche areas, demonstrated through a dissertation or prior projects. In Honduras, expertise in tropical diseases or sustainable development is highly valued.
- Preferred experience: A track record of peer-reviewed publications (at least 3-5 in reputable journals), successful grant applications, and conference presentations. Experience with fieldwork or interdisciplinary teams adds value.
- Skills and competencies: Proficiency in data analysis software (e.g., R, SPSS), scientific writing, project management, and ethical research practices. Bilingualism in Spanish and English facilitates international funding.
These elements ensure Research Fellows can deliver impactful results, even in resource-constrained settings like Honduras.
🔬 Research Fellow Opportunities in Honduras
Honduras' higher education landscape features institutions like the Universidad Nacional Autónoma de Honduras (UNAH) and Universidad Tecnológica Centroamericana (UNITEC), where Research Fellows drive national priorities. With research and development spending at about 0.1% of GDP, positions often rely on international funding from USAID, the European Union, or foundations focusing on climate resilience and biodiversity in the Mesoamerican Biological Corridor.
Typical projects involve studying hurricane impacts, coffee sustainability, or vector-borne diseases like dengue. Research Fellows in Honduras collaborate on applied research, publishing in journals and influencing policy. Despite challenges like limited infrastructure, the role offers fieldwork in diverse ecosystems and pathways to tenure-track positions. Key Definitions
- Peer-reviewed publication: A research paper vetted by experts before journal inclusion, essential for credibility.
- Grant-funded research: Projects financed by competitive awards from governments or organizations, common for Fellows.
- Postdoctoral researcher: A scholar after PhD gaining experience; often overlaps with Research Fellow roles.
